
Love in a Time of Pestilence by Heather Goddin
It is about the events and emotions that shape or have shaped our lives. It is at times moving or tragic. At others it is funny, often quirky. At times it makes people weep but there is always a hope of better things. Not completely serious.
Heather Goddin trained as a professional singer until the age of 26. She has worked as a library assistant and in a factory, before entering local government. Retiring early, she moved to Suffolk with her late partner. She has been writing poetry for 40 years. Love in a Time of Pestilence is her fifth collection of poetry.
